The video tutorial introduces students to famous composers Bach, Beethoven, and Mozart, exploring their contributions to music history. It covers the evolution of music notation from ancient times through the Renaissance and Baroque periods, highlighting Bach's work. The Classical period is discussed with a focus on Beethoven and Mozart. Students are then guided to create their own music compositions, learning about rhythm, notes, and finger numbers. The tutorial concludes with practical exercises using solfege and finger numbers to play music on the piano.
